DETROIT & MACKINAC RY. v. PAPER CO.

Nos. 336-340.

248 U.S. 30 (1918)

DETROIT & MACKINAC RAILWAY COMPANY v. FLETCHER PAPER COMPANY. SAME v. ISLAND MILL LUMBER COMPANY. SAME v. CHURCHILL LUMBER COMPANY. SAME v. RICHARDSON LUMBER COMPANY. SAME v. MICHIGAN VENEER COMPANY.

Supreme Court of United States.

Decided November 18, 1918.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Edward S. Clark and Mr. I.S. Canfield, for defendants in error, submitted the motions.

Mr. James McNamara and Mr. Fred A. Baker, for plaintiff in error, in opposition to the motions. Mr. C.R. Henry was also on the briefs.


Motions to dismiss or affirm or place on the summary docket submitted October 8, 1918.

MR. JUSTICE HOLMES delivered the opinion of the court.

These five suits were actions of assumpsit brought to recover the difference between the rates fixed by the Michigan Railroad Commission on logs carried wholly within the State, from points on the defendant's (the plaintiff in error's) road to Alpena, and the higher rates that the defendant actually charged.
